Motorist Mileage Meter

Take a trip back in time. A 1950s road trip, where there's no cell phones or GPS -- just your map, intuition, and guts. Planning your trip was a necessity or you might go hungry, run out of gas, or have nowhere but your car to sleep. That's where this handy advertisement comes in. They calculated the distance from their location to points around the country. They sat in diners, hotels and motels, service stations as advertising and helped travelers plan their routes. This particular one originates in Lawndale, California (Los Angeles County)Measures approximately 10.25" long (not including knobs), 8.25" wide, 6.75" tall.
